* gdbarch.sh (EXTRACT_STRUCT_VALUE_ADDRESS_P): Delete definition.

(EXTRACT_STRUCT_VALUE_ADDRESS): Change to a function with
predicate.
* gdbarch.h, gdbarch.c: Regenerate.
* values.c (value_being_returned): Change the reference to
EXTRACT_STRUCT_VALUE_ADDRESS_P to a function call.
